Transaction 5bc274c3fc7796ee8b12f29a406e14259bc344491a90e14d11dfb807cab11da0

7 Input
2 Outputs
  • 5bc274c3fc7796ee8b12f29a406e14259bc344491a90e14d11dfb807cab11da0:0
  • value  320478604
    address  165xdie9ztkBngUh7dMfvGwDoujwKYSVkC
  • 5bc274c3fc7796ee8b12f29a406e14259bc344491a90e14d11dfb807cab11da0:1
  • value  541774763
    address  364L1FcgAaAghozaBDHnNifGxz123BC6XB